Understanding the Importance of JEEP SUSPENSION Systems

The JEEP SUSPENSION system is the backbone of your vehicle's ability to traverse challenging terrains. It serves several pivotal functions, including:

  • Absorbing shocks and vibrations from uneven surfaces, ensuring smoother rides.
  • Maintaining tire contact with the ground for better traction and control.
  • Supporting the vehicle's weight and cargo, especially during heavy off-road loads.
  • Enhancing stability and handling when navigating through obstacles and sharp turns.
  • Protecting vital components like axles, driveshafts, and drivetrain elements from excessive stress and damage.

Types of JEEP SUSPENSION Systems for Off-Road Enthusiasts

Understanding the different types of JEEP SUSPENSION setups can help off-road enthusiasts and vehicle owners choose the right enhancements tailored to their specific needs. The primary types include:

1. Leaf Spring Suspension

The classic choice for ruggedness and durability, leaf spring suspensions are known for their simple design and ability to handle heavy loads. They are particularly favored in traditional off-road and heavy-duty applications.

2. Coil Spring Suspension

This modern design offers improved ride comfort, better articulation, and enhanced handling. Coil springs are prevalent in many modern Jeep models and aftermarket upgrades due to their superior shock absorption capabilities.

3. Independent Suspension

Providing superior flexibility and comfort by allowing each wheel to move independently, this setup is ideal for off-road adventures requiring sharp handling and minimal body roll.

4. Four-Link and Three-Link Suspension Systems

These advanced configurations offer increased wheel articulation and articulation control, making them popular choices among serious off-roaders and customizers seeking maximum off-road performance.

Components of a High-Performance JEEP SUSPENSION

Understanding the key components that comprise a JEEP SUSPENSION system is vital for both maintenance and upgrade purposes. These include:

  • Shocks and Struts: Absorbers that manage vertical motion and dissipate shocks from rough terrain.
  • Coil Springs and Leaf Springs: Elements that support load and absorb impacts.
  • Control Arms: Linkages that control wheel motion and alignment.
  • Axle Assemblies: Transmit power to the wheels while accommodating suspension movement.
  • Track Bars and PanHacks: Stabilize lateral movement, maintaining proper wheel alignment during off-road maneuvers.

How to Upgrade Your JEEP SUSPENSION for Off-Road Excellence

Upgrading the JEEP SUSPENSION is a strategic process that significantly enhances off-road capabilities, ride quality, and vehicle durability. Key upgrade options include:

1. Installing Lift Kits

Lifting your Jeep increases ground clearance, allowing for larger tires and better approach/departure angles. Types of lift kits include body lifts and performance suspension lifts. When selecting a lift kit, consider your primary off-road terrain and intended vehicle use.

2. Upgrading Shock Absorbers

High-quality, heavy-duty shocks such as monotube or twin-tube designs improve shock absorption, prevent bottoming out, and maintain tire traction over tough terrains.

3. Replacing Springs and Control Arms

Aftermarket springs and control arms offer increased durability and articulation, improving wheel travel and obstacle navigation capabilities.

4. Enhancing Linkage and Bushings

Upgraded tie rods, sway bars, and bushings reduce flex and maintain alignment, boosting handling precision in extreme off-road conditions.

Maintenance of Your JEEP SUSPENSION: Ensuring Longevity and Performance

Proper maintenance extends the lifespan of your JEEP SUSPENSION system, ensuring consistent performance. Essential maintenance tips include:

  • Regularly inspecting shocks, springs, and bushings for signs of wear, cracks, or leaks.
  • Lubricating joints and moving parts to prevent rust and corrosion.
  • Aligning the wheels periodically to prevent uneven tire wear and handling issues.
  • Checking for rust, dirt, and debris that can accelerate component deterioration.
  • Monitoring tire pressure and tread wear, as improper inflation impacts suspension performance.
